The Garmin Forerunner 255 sports watch accompanies you during your regular running sessions as well as new athletic challenges. Its sophisticated design helps you achieve even the most ambitious goals.
You have access to more than 30 sports profiles, allowing you to maximize your potential in activities including running, cycling, triathlon, hiking, and swimming. In swimming, you can choose between pool and open water modes.
Equipped with the Elevate Gen 4 heart rate sensor and the Pulse Ox 2.0 oximeter, the Garmin Forerunner 255 captures vital fitness data. Based on this information, it provides training recommendations and health data right after you wake up.
To enhance your performance, the watch analyzes your recovery post-exercise. The Garmin Connect App helps you organize and create workouts tailored to your level and goals.
The multi-band GPS precisely calculates your position even in challenging environments. The barometric altimeter is also beneficial during your outdoor adventures.
The watch features the Fitness Age 2.0 algorithm and the HRV test, allowing you to monitor your health condition. The HRV test evaluates the time interval between heartbeats to measure your fitness and stress levels.
The updated watch, designed for longer battery life, runs up to 30 hours in GPS mode and up to 14 days in smartwatch mode.
Technical description
More than 30 Sports Profiles
Multiband GPS and Multi-GNSS (GPS, GLONASS, GALILEO): for precise positioning, even in canyons and in the city
Elevate Gen 4 Heart Rate Sensor: 24/7 heart rate monitoring, even underwater
Pulse Ox 2.0 Oximeter: Blood oxygen saturation measurement
Barometric Altimeter: Analyzes elevation differences and predicts weather changes
Compass, Accelerometer, and Thermometer
24/7 Activity Tracker: Counts steps, sleep, calories, floors, distance, physical age, daily effort, and intensity minutes
Automatic Training Recommendations based on your fitness, stress level, and sleep
Performance and Training Features of the Forerunner 255
- HRV / HRV Test: Displays fitness and health status
- Running Power: Calculates the power output while running (requires an HRM strap with Running Dynamics, not included)
- Race Predictor Trend: Predicts running times and tracks your performance in a diagram
- PacePro: Manages pace over a set distance
- Elevate Gen 4 Continuous Heart Rate Monitoring: Measures the intensity of sports activities and stress levels
- Garmin Coach: Downloadable training plans
Wellness Features of the Forerunner 255
- Morning Report: Summary of sleep quality, training suggestions, weather, and more
- Body Battery
- Fitness Age 2.0: Displays physical age based on VO2 Max, resting heart rate, BMI, or body fat percentage

Materials and Features of the Forerunner 255
- Colors: Grey, Red, and Black
- Battery Life: 30 hours in GPS mode and up to 14 days as a Connected Watch
- Weight: 49 g
- Dimensions: 45.6 mm x 45.6 mm x 12.9 mm
- Water Resistance: 5 ATM
- Screen Size: 1.3''
- Screen Resolution: 260 x 260 pixels
- Screen Type: Memory-In-Pixel Color Display (MIP)
- Storage: 2000 hours of activity data
The silicone strap and the charging cable are included in the package.
